Restrict Recipient Selection Method
Specifies whether any restrictions apply to the method of selecting recipients of Fax, 
Internet Fax, Server Fax, and scanned (E-mail) documents. Select [Only From Address 
Book] to disable input of recipients from the keyboard screen and buttons on the control 
panel, and restrict recipients to only those registered in the Address Book.
Restrict User to Edit Address Book
Specifies whether to permit users to edit the Address Book.

Copy Tab
This feature allows you to define the functions of the paper tray buttons and copy 
magnification buttons shown in [Paper Supply] on the [Copy] screen.
1.
Select [Copy Tab] in the 
[Features] menu.
2.
Change the required settings.
3.
Select [Close].
Paper Supply - Button 2 to 4
Specifies the paper trays for paper tray buttons 2 to 4 shown in [Paper Supply] on the 
[Copy] screen. This allocation allows you to easily select the paper trays you frequently 
use, with the exception of Trays 3 and 4 of the optional High Capacity Tandem Tray.
Reduce/Enlarge - Button 3 and 4
Specifies the magnifications for Reduce/Enlarge buttons 3 and 4 shown in 
[Reduce/Enlarge] on the [Copy] screen. This allocation allows you to easily select the 
copy magnifications you frequently use.
Copy Defaults
This feature allows you to set the default for each copy feature. The copy settings are 
returned to the defaults set here when the power is switched on, when the Energy 
Saver mode is cancelled, or when the <Clear All> button is pressed. If you set defaults 
for the features you frequently use, you can quickly copy documents without changing 
the settings each time.
